1. Open the Run command via Start-> Run or press the Windows Logo + R on your keyboard.
If you are using Windows Vista or Windows 7, you can also open the Start Menu and use the Search field to type in for the next step.
2. In the box you opened in step 1, type;outlook.exe
3. Press the SPACEBAR once, and then type a forward slash mark (/) followed by the switch you want to use (see the list below). For example, if you want to use resetnavpane the command you type in the Open box should look like this:
outlook.exe /resetnavpane (note the SPACE)
4. To run the command, click OK.
